Development prospects of intelligent warehousing industry

(Note: This article is reprinted from the China Chamber of Commerce Industry Research Institute)

Development Prospects of the Smart Warehousing Industry

Favorable Policies Boost Industry Development
In recent years, the Chinese government has vigorously promoted the development of smart warehousing, intelligent logistics, smart factories, and the Industrial Internet, among other smart manufacturing products and industries, introducing a series of favorable policies. Benefiting from the strong support of national policies and the rapid development of manufacturing enterprises towards automation and intelligence, the investment scale of China's manufacturing enterprises in smart manufacturing systems and smart warehousing logistics systems has continued to grow, reducing costs in logistics and warehousing. Simultaneously, with the rapid increase in domestic demand for smart logistics and smart manufacturing markets, coupled with capital support, a group of small and medium-sized enterprises engaged in this industry have emerged, essentially forming a complete smart logistics and smart manufacturing system industrial chain, ushering in a period of rapid industry development.


Technological Applications Drive the Intelligent Automation of Warehousing Systems
With the rapid development of computer and communication technologies, smart warehousing logistics systems have gradually improved and progressed. Cutting-edge technologies have been integrated into all aspects of warehousing, transportation, and distribution, significantly enhancing the efficiency and service quality of warehousing logistics. Based on Internet technology, smart warehousing logistics systems can conduct real-time monitoring and analysis of various logistics links, making warehousing logistics management more accurate and efficient. Internet of Things (IoT) technology enables tracking, identification, and monitoring of goods, facilitating the circulation of label information in logistics processes and realizing intelligent, interactive communication between logistics nodes and goods. By empowering all aspects of warehousing logistics, artificial intelligence achieves intelligent allocation of logistics resources, optimizes logistics processes, reduces resource waste, and significantly improves warehousing logistics operational efficiency. The digitization of smart warehousing logistics generates vast amounts of data, and with the support of big data technology, warehousing logistics big data supports various decision-making applications, enhancing the operational quality and management efficiency of warehousing logistics. Cloud computing technology has been applied to the construction of warehousing logistics cloud platforms, which connect and integrate data from various processes within the smart warehousing logistics system and further adjust warehousing logistics management based on analytical data.


Downstream Applications Drive Industry Growth
From the perspective of industry participation, Chinese smart warehousing enterprises are highly engaged in industries such as pharmaceuticals, food and beverages, e-commerce logistics, automobiles, 3C appliances, and tobacco. However, as land and labor costs continue to rise, not only does the circulation industry have an increasing demand for smart logistics systems, but traditional manufacturing industries also need to improve automation rates, full-industry-chain collaboration, and production efficiency, all of which place demands on logistics. Smart warehousing has gradually penetrated into emerging industries such as military logistics, cold chain logistics, new energy, petrochemicals, and semiconductors.
